| Industry | Application | Process |
|---|---|---|
| Coatings & Inks | Used as a reactive diluent and crosslinking monomer to improve coating adhesion, hardness, and chemical resistance | Radical polymerization in ultraviolet (UV) curing systems |
| Adhesives | Enhances adhesive cure speed and bond strength, particularly on low-surface-energy substrates | UV- or thermally initiated polymerization in pressure-sensitive and structural adhesive formulations |
| Personal Care Products | Acts as a hydrophilic monomer for synthesizing water-soluble polymers to improve film formation and moisturization | Emulsion or solution polymerization in shampoos, conditioners, and similar formulations |
| Water Treatment | Used to synthesize high-molecular-weight flocculants to enhance suspended solids capture efficiency | Free-radical copolymerization with other monomers to produce polyelectrolytes |
| Medical Polymers | Employed in the preparation of biocompatible hydrogels, such as drug delivery carriers or tissue engineering scaffolds | Crosslinking polymerization, typically copolymerized with monomers like N-isopropylacrylamide |
| 3D Printing Materials | Incorporated as a component of photocurable resins to improve print resolution and interlayer adhesion | Photoreactive monomer in stereolithography (SLA) and digital light processing (DLP) processes |
| Detection Item | Common Analytical Method | Method Overview |
|---|---|---|
| Acid Value | Acid-Base Titration | Neutralization of free carboxylic acid groups with standardized KOH solution using phenolphthalein indicator. |
| Hydroxyl Value | Acetylation Titration | Acetylation of hydroxyl groups with acetic anhydride, followed by back-titration of unreacted anhydride with NaOH. |
| Acrylate Content | 1H NMR Spectroscopy | Quantification of vinyl proton signals (delta 5.8–6.4 ppm) relative to internal standard or polymer backbone protons. |
| Molecular Weight (Mn, Mw) | Gel Permeation Chromatography (GPC) | Separation by hydrodynamic volume in solution using calibrated polystyrene standards and refractive index detection. |
| Water Content | Karl Fischer Titration | Electrochemical titration based on the reaction of iodine with water in a methanol-based solvent system. |
| Appearance | Visual Inspection | Assessment of liquid clarity and absence of visible particulates or phase separation under controlled lighting. |
| Color (APHA) | Colorimetry | Comparison of sample color to APHA platinum-cobalt standard solutions using a spectrophotometer or visual comparator. |
| Residual Acrylic Acid | Gas Chromatography (GC) | Separation and quantification of volatile acrylic acid using flame ionization detection after derivatization if needed. |
| Residual Methanol | Gas Chromatography (GC) | Direct headspace or direct injection GC with FID detection using external calibration standards. |
| Peroxide Value | Iodometric Titration | Oxidation of iodide to iodine by peroxides, followed by titration of liberated iodine with standardized sodium thiosulfate. |
| Heavy Metals (as Pb) | ICP-OES | Multi-element quantitative analysis after acid digestion, based on element-specific atomic emission intensities. |
| Total Chloride Content | Ion Chromatography (IC) | Separation and quantification of chloride ions using conductivity detection after aqueous extraction. |
